How they compare

Netherlands currently reports 17.65 against 11.33 in Sub-Saharan Africa (World Bank regions), a difference of 6.32.

That makes Netherlands's figure about 1.6 times Sub-Saharan Africa (World Bank regions)'s.

Across all 23 years both countries report, Netherlands has been ahead every year.

Netherlands ranks 133rd and Sub-Saharan Africa (World Bank regions) ranks 132nd of 193 countries.

Netherlands has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Netherlands Sub-Saharan Africa (World Bank regions) Difference Ahead
2000s 17.9 6.57 11.33 Netherlands
2010s 17.27 8.91 8.36 Netherlands
2020s 17.54 10.94 6.6 Netherlands

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
